    We started with like 15-20 red and blue shrimp and a couple of ramshorn snails in a 10 gallon tank. We later added a couple of vampire shrimp (which are amazing), a couple of endlers, 2 pygmy cories, and some tiny tetras. It has now become somewhat of a breeding tank. There's now a ton of shrimp and snails and a few extra endlers after they also bred. The snails get fed to our pea puffers in another tank. Since mixing the blue and red shrimp, they created some amazing hybrids. There's red and blue, red and white, blue and white, powder blue, black, brown, a few snowballs, brown, some weird color that looks like a mix of a bag of skittles mixed together. There's even a few red, white, and blue which are pretty awesome being in the USA.

    I have been running a 30cm / 1ft tank for about 2 years, primarily trying my hand at growing aquatic plants (mostly crypts) - in the last year I have added about 7 'blue dream' shrimp. There was a couple of deaths initially, now there is at least 12 that I have been able to count, maybe more as the baby shrimp are dark at first and with the soil substrate being dark brown to black, they are not easily seen so that they can be counted! The amazing thing about this is that I have not really put any other food in there, maybe the occasional broken up pieces of an algae wafer/pellet, they have been feeding off the bio film the whole time! It makes me wonder if I start putting food like what you have mentioned here in there whether the population grow even more?
